I don't know if i'm caring for my goldfish right, so here's a bit of info about how i care for them. Please tell me what i am doing wrong and how i can get it right. Thanks.
Housing: I have a 7 gallon tank with one common goldfish and one comet goldfish. I have lighting and an air pump, but i don't have a filter. Everything in my tank is safe for the fish. I will be getting a bigger tank when they grow out of this one, or maybe i will put them in a small (inside) pond. Too many hazards outside.
Feeding: Because i don't have a filter, i only feed my fish a pinch of flake food every cuople of days. They eat all of it and then they search the gravel for more.
Partial waterchange: I do a partial water change of 40% everyweek. I use tap water with de-chloranter in so it is safe. I also scrape the tank sides with alge scrapers and check that the plants, light and air pump are fine. I use a siphon to siphone the water out.
Health: My fish are doing fine, but if they were to ever fall sick, i would put them in a quratine tank(it's not really a tank, it's more of a bowl.) I check for signs of illness everday anyway, so i know that they would be sick. Sometimes my fish have days when they are lazy with clamped, droopy fins. Is this something to be worried about?
